No, you typically don't pay any additional fees specifically after a seat allotment in MHT CET counselling. However, there might be institute-specific fees associated with the admission process itself.
Here's a breakdown:
- The MHT CET counselling fee is what you pay before seat allotment to participate in the process.
- Once you are allotted a seat, you would need to pay the admission fees set by the specific college you are admitted to. These fees may include tuition, hostel charges (if applicable), and other miscellaneous fees.
- Make sure to confirm the specific fee structure with the college you are interested in after the seat allotment.

So, if you're like me and trying to figure out which path to take between Calcutta Media Institute (CMI) and NSHM Business School, here's the scoop. At CMI, it's all about diving deep into media management and digital marketing through specialized postgraduate diploma and certificate programs. You'll get hands-on training geared specifically towards the media industry. On the flip side, NSHM offers a bunch of degree programs, which could be great if you're interested in exploring a wider range of subjects and potential career paths beyond media and marketing. After the release of the MCAER PG CET 2024 admit card, applicants can download it from the official website of MUAEB. Candidates have to log in using their application number and password to download the MCAER PG CET admit card.
Students are advised to check their interent speed before downloading it and along with that the admit card of MCAER PG CET 2024 must be downloaded on the advised web browser only otherwise applicant may face issue.

The admit card of MCAER PG CET was released on May 20, 2024. This admit card was out, at least 10 days before the exam as the exam is scheduled to be conducted between May 31 to June 2, 2024.
The exam conducting authorities will release the admit card online on the official website. Students after downloading the admit card need to check that all the details mentioned in the admit card are correct and if there is any discrepancy then they immediately need to contact the exam conducting authorities and get it corrected.
